Investment at Fair Value
Veritone Investment Agreement. On August 15, 2016, Acacia entered into an Investment Agreement with Veritone, Inc. (“Veritone”) pursuant to which Acacia funded in aggregate $20 million of loans to Veritone which were converted into 1,523,746 shares of Veritone’s common stock upon the public offering of Veritone common stock on May 17, 2017 (“IPO”), based on a conversion price of $13.61 per share. Veritone also issued Acacia a total of 154,312 warrants to purchase shares of Veritone’s common stock at an exercise price of $13.61 per share expiring in 2020.
In addition, in August 2016, Veritone issued Acacia a five-year warrant to purchase up to $50 million worth of shares of Veritone’s common stock at an exercise price of $13.61 per share subject to certain adjustments. Upon the consummation of Veritone’s IPO, Acacia exercised its option to purchase an additional 2,150,335 shares of Veritone common stock, at an aggregate purchase price of $29.3 million. Acacia then received an additional warrant that provides for the issuance of an additional 809,400 shares of Veritone common stock at an exercise price of $13.61 per share expiring in 2022.
Veritone Bridge Loan. On March 14, 2017, Acacia entered into an additional secured convertible promissory note with Veritone pursuant to which Acacia funded $4.0 million which was converted into 445,440 shares of Veritone’s common stock at a conversion price of $13.61 per share in the IPO. Acacia also received a 10-year warrant to purchase up to 156,720 shares of Veritone common stock at an exercise price of $13.61 per share expiring in 2027.
As a result of the foregoing transactions, Acacia received an aggregate total of 4,119,521 of Veritone shares and 1,120,432 of warrants in Veritone. On October 5, 2018, a registration statement on Form S-3 registering all of Acacia’s shares of Veritone common stock was declared effective by the SEC. During the year ended December 31, 2018, Acacia sold 2,700,000 shares Veritone common stock at prices ranging from $4.95 to $10.44 and recorded a realized loss of $19.1 million.
At December 31, 2018, the fair value of the 1,419,521 shares of Veritone common stock owned by Acacia totaled $5,395,000. At December 31, 2018, the fair value of the 1,120,432 common stock purchase warrants held by Acacia totaled $2,064,000. The Veritone common shares were subject to a lock-up agreement that expired on August 15, 2018, subsequent to which the fair value of the common stock (Level 1) and fair value of the common stock purchase warrants (Level 2) excluded a DLOM.
Changes in the fair value of Acacia’s investment in Veritone are recorded as unrealized gains or losses in the consolidated statements of operations. Miso Robotics Investment
    
In June 2017, Acacia made an investment in the Series A Preferred financing round for Miso Robotics, Inc. (“Miso Robotics”), an innovative leader in robotics and artificial intelligence solutions, totaling $2,250,000, acquiring a 22.6% ownership interest in Series A preferred stock of Miso Robotics, and one board seat. In February 2018, Acacia made an additional equity investment in the Series B Preferred financing round for Miso Robotics totaling $6,000,000, increasing its ownership interest (Series B preferred stock) in Miso Robotics to approximately 30%, and acquiring an additional board seat.

As of February 2018, the preferred stock was not deemed to be in-substance common stock due to the substantive liquidation preference associated with the preferred stock. As such, as of February 2018, the cumulative investment in Miso Robotics is recorded at cost and assessed for any impairment at each balance sheet date. Prior to February 2018, the equity method of accounting was applied.
